Hoku Scientific, Inc. (NASDAQ: HOKU) Subsidiary Signs Second Major Polysilicon Supply Contract within a Week, Deal Worth $284 Million Over 10 Years

Hoku Materials, Inc., a wholly-owned subsidiary of Hoku Scientific, Inc. (HOKU), a diversified alternative energy technology company in China, announced this afternoon the signing of a $284 million polysilicon supply agreement with a subsidiary of Tianwei New Energy Holdings Co., Ltd. that manufactures photovoltaic cells and silicon wafers. The contract calls for delivery of polysilicon to Tianwei over a ten-year period to commence in early 2010. Portfolio Recovery Associates, Inc. (NASDAQ: PRAA) Acquires Broussard Partners & Associates

Portfolio Recovery Associates, Inc. (PRAA), established in 1996, is a full-service provider of outsourced receivables management and related services. The company purchases, collects and manages portfolios of defaulted consumer receivables that consist of unpaid obligations of individuals to credit originators (banks, credit unions, consumer and auto finance companies, and retail merchants). In addition, the company also provides collection services, including revenue administration for government entities through its RDS and MuniServices businesses, collateral-location services for credit originators via its IGS subsidiary, and bankruptcy servicing through PRA Receivables Management, LLC. UFP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: UFPT) Reports Solid Q2 Results

UFP Technologies Inc. (UFPT), a manufacturer of protective packaging solutions for a wide range of end markets, reported second quarter financial results this morning. Revenues increased 22.8% year over year to $28.5 million. Net income grew 61.1% to $1.57 million, or 25 cents per share, compared to $0.98 million, or 17 cents per share, for the same period last year.
